Question: no sex drive


 bj698267 - Thu Dec 30, 2004 7:30 pm

I am a 27 year old male who has lost his sex drive how do i get it back?
 Dr. Tamer Fouad - Sat Jan 01, 2005 7:46 am

User avatar Hypoactive sexual desire disorder is increasingly being recognized as the most common of all sexual disorders in both males and females. The problem is a very complex one with psychological problems being a direct cause of HSDD. Another potential cause that needs to be excluded is hormone imbalance (testosterone). This is a more curable cause. I would advise you to seek medical attention in order to run a few tests and exclude psychiatric depression. Depression in this case should be treated with an antidepressant that is not an SSRI (e.g. Bupropion hydrochloride), as other antidepressants can lead to drive suppression as a side effect.
